Te whiwhinga mahi | The Opportunity


Starship Children's Health (Auckland), the leading provider of child health care in New Zealand and the South Pacific, has an exciting opportunity for two fixed term full-time positions as Fellows in Paediatric Anaesthesia and Paediatric Intensive Care for up to 12 months commencing in January 2025.

The positions are six months in paediatric anaesthesia and six months in paediatric intensive care.


The Department of Paediatric Anaesthesia and Pain Medicine is responsible for the management of approximately 11,000 cases per year through 7 operating rooms at Starship Children's Hospital plus additional operating room sessions at a separate day surgery facility, Greenlane Surgical Unit (GSU).

A further 1,500 patients are anaesthetised for procedures outside the Operating Rooms which include MRI, CT, Cardiac Investigations, radiotherapy and other radiology procedures at various locations at Starship Children's hospital and Auckland City Hospital.

In this role, you will receive exposure to a wide range of paediatric anaesthesia in all major subspecialty areas.

We anaesthetise children all over New Zealand, and there will be exposure to airway surgery, cardiac anaesthesia, neurosurgery, orthopaedics and paediatric general surgery.

There is an expectation that our fellows will be involved in audit activities and contribute to other departmental activities. Some participation in on call duties will be required.


In order to be competitive, you should be either nearing the end of your training or have recently completed a formal anaesthesia training programme, but seeking additional structured training in paediatric anaesthesia and intensive care.

Ko wai mātou | Our Organisation
We are Te Whatu Ora Te Toka Tumai Auckland.

We are part of Te Whatu Ora - Health New Zealand, the overarching organisation for New Zealand's national health service.

We provide health and disability services to more than half a million people living in central Auckland, regional services for Northland and greater Auckland, and specialist national services for the whole of New Zealand.

Our main sites are Auckland City Hospital, Greenlane Clinical Centre and Starship Children's Hospital, located in central Auckland.


Te Toka Tumai | Starship Child Health is the leading provider of child health care in New Zealand and the South Pacific, providing world-class inpatient, outpatient, trauma, emergency, and urgent care to children and their whānau.

Starship is part of Te whatu Ora Te Toka Tumai Auckland.

We seek to lead New Zealand in paediatric service delivery through the building of our reputation as a national centre of excellence in child health care.
